The application of rocker switch in our life

2024-03-15

Rocker switches are ubiquitous in modern life and are used in a wide range of applications due to their simplicity, versatility, and ease of use. Here are some common applications of rocker switches in our daily lives:


1. Home Lighting: Rocker switches are commonly used to control lighting fixtures in homes, offices, and commercial buildings. They provide a simple on/off function and are often installed on walls near doorways for easy access.


2. Appliances: Many household appliances, such as ovens, dishwashers, washing machines, and microwaves, feature rocker switches to control power and various functions. These switches are often used to turn the appliance on/off or to select different operating modes.


3. Electronics: Rocker switches are used in electronic devices and gadgets, including computers, televisions, audio equipment, and gaming consoles. They are typically used as power switches or to control specific functions, such as volume or brightness.


4. Automotive: Rocker switches are commonly found in vehicles to control various functions such as headlights, turn signals, windshield wipers, power windows, and door locks. They are often mounted on the dashboard or door panels for easy access by the driver and passengers.


5. Boats and Marine Applications: Rocker switches are widely used in marine and boating applications to control navigation lights, bilge pumps, winches, and other electrical systems on boats and yachts. Marine-grade rocker switches are designed to withstand harsh environments, including exposure to water and salt.


6. Industrial Equipment: Rocker switches are used in industrial machinery and equipment to control power, start/stop functions, and various operating modes. They are commonly found in manufacturing plants, factories, and production facilities.


7. Medical Equipment: Rocker switches are used in medical devices and equipment, such as patient monitors, diagnostic tools, and surgical instruments. They provide convenient and reliable control over different functions and settings.


8. Outdoor and Recreational Equipment: Rocker switches are used in outdoor and recreational equipment, including garden tools, power tools, RVs, campers, and ATVs. They are often used to control lighting, heating/cooling systems, and other electrical components.


9. Safety Equipment: Rocker switches are sometimes used in safety equipment and emergency devices, such as fire alarms, security systems, and emergency lighting. They provide a quick and intuitive way to activate or deactivate critical functions during emergencies.


Overall, rocker switches play a crucial role in controlling various electrical and electronic systems in our daily lives, providing convenience, functionality, and reliability across a wide range of applications.
